Abstract

A controllable oscillator includes an output oscillation adjust module operably coupled to an oscillator for producing an effective output oscillation based on an oscillation control signal. The output oscillation adjust module includes an output select block that produces the effective output oscillation from a sequence of selected taps from the plurality of taps of the oscillator. A tap adjust control generator, responsive to the oscillation control signal generates a sequence of tap adjust control signals that command the output select block to select the sequence of selected taps from the plurality of taps. The tap adjust control generator includes an integrator having an integrator output, responsive to the oscillation control signal and a modulo(x) module for producing the sequence of tap adjust control signals based on the integrator output.

Claims (29)

1. A phase locked loop comprising:

a difference detection module operably coupled to determine a difference signal based on at least one of a phase difference and a frequency difference between a reference oscillation and a feedback oscillation;

a loop filter module operably coupled to convert the difference signal into a control signal;

an oscillator having a plurality of taps for producing a plurality of outputs, the oscillator operably coupled to convert the control signal into an output oscillation;

an output oscillation adjust module operably coupled to the oscillator for producing an effective output oscillation based on an oscillation control signal, wherein the output oscillation adjust module includes:

an output select block, operably coupled to the plurality of taps, for producing the effective output oscillation from a sequence of selected taps from the plurality of taps based on a sequence of tap adjust control signals; and

a tap adjust control generator, responsive to the oscillation control signal that includes an integrator having an integrator output, responsive to the oscillation control signal and a modulo(x) module that produces the sequence of tap adjust control signals based on the integrator output; and

a divider module operably coupled to convert the effective output oscillation into the feedback oscillation.

2. The phase locked loop of claim 1 wherein the value of x is equal to the number of the plurality of taps.

3. The phase locked loop of claim 1 wherein the divider module is responsive to the oscillation control signal to produce the feedback oscillation by dividing the frequency of the effective output oscillation F eo by a selected divisor.

4. The phase locked loop of claim 3 wherein the divider module includes a fractional divider.

5. The phase locked loop of claim 1 wherein the effective output oscillation has a frequency F eo and the output oscillation has a frequency F o and wherein F eo >F o .

6. A method for producing an output oscillation, the method comprising the steps of:

generating a difference signal based on at least one of phase a difference and a frequency difference between a reference oscillation and a feedback oscillation;

filtering the difference signal to produce a control signal;

converting the control signal into an output oscillation using a controlled oscillation module;

adjusting the output oscillation to produce an effective output oscillation based on an oscillation control signal; and

dividing the effective output oscillation by a selected divisor to produce the feedback oscillation;

wherein the effective output oscillation has a frequency F eo and the output oscillation has a frequency F o and wherein |F eo −F o |/F o <0.5.

7. The method of claim 6 wherein the step of adjusting the output oscillation further comprises, producing the effective output oscillation from one of the plurality of taps.

8. The method of claim 7 wherein the step of adjusting the output oscillation further comprises, selecting a corresponding sequence of selected taps from the plurality of taps based on a sequence of tap adjust control signals.

9. The method of claim 8 wherein the step of adjusting the output oscillation further comprises, generating the sequence of tap adjust control signals using an integrator having an integrator output, responsive to the oscillation control signal and the reference oscillation, and a modulo(x) module for producing the sequence of tap adjust control signals based on the integrator output.

10. The method of claim 9 wherein the value of x is equal to the number of the plurality of taps.

11. The method of claim 6 wherein the selected divisor is an integer.

12. The method of claim 6 wherein the selected divisor is a fraction.

13. A controlled oscillator comprising:

an oscillator a plurality of taps coupled to a corresponding plurality of outputs, the oscillator operably coupled to convert a control signal into an output oscillation; and

an output oscillation adjust module operably coupled to the oscillator for producing an effective output oscillation based on an oscillation control signal, wherein the output oscillation adjust module includes an output select block, operably coupled to the plurality of taps, for producing the effective output oscillation from a sequence of selected taps from the plurality of taps, and a tap adjust control generator, responsive to the oscillation control signal for generating a sequence of tap adjust control signals that command the output select block to select the sequence of selected taps from the plurality of taps, wherein the tap adjust control generator includes an integrator having an integrator output, responsive to the oscillation control signal and a modulo(x) module for producing the sequence of tap adjust control signals based on the integrator output.

14. The controlled oscillator of claim 13 wherein the value of x is equal to the number of the plurality of taps.
